Arrow First Ever Collegiate Competition MARCH 19TH-MARCH 25 - KEY WEST

This is the first ever collegiate kiteboarding competition, the purpose of this event is to set a presedence for a collegiate kiteboarding league, as well as to open the sport of kitesurfing to college students throughout the country.
COMPETITION INFORMATION
The event will begin next Monday, March 19th, at 10:00 A.M. Registration will be at the green tent with cabrinha flags on the East side of Smathers Beach. There are three seperate events throughout the week and riders with current college id's can enter free. There will be two days open for each aspect of the event, in case of shortage of wind. Should the whole week be windy we'll do each event on its first alloted day and use the second to host demos, expression sessions, and kite parties.
Monday the 19th and Tuesday the 20th, will be open for the freestyle comp. the event will either be hosted at smathers beach in front of the registration tent, or out on the grass flats, with the kitehouse house boat. Wind forecasts will be posted updated regularly prior to the event stating the location.
Wednesday the 21st and Thursday the 22nd will be open for a kickers and sliders comp, this will be held in the same way depending on wind, stay tuned.
Friday the 23rd and Saturday the 24th will be the days for the boarder-x. This will be run by Neil Hutchinson and X-Rated Kiteboarding, the boarder-x will be capped at 32 and will preferably be finished on friday, with the awards ceremony that night. College riders will have full priority in all events but if there are open spots, we will except last minute registrations. Top college rider will win a Slingshot Machine thanks to Neil Hutchinson and Slingshot Kiteboarding, all other prizes will be alloted in normal order after that. If both friday and saturday are perfectly windy, plan on completing the Collegiate event friday and a General Entry Boarder-X, entry fee's will be put up for prizes as well as leftover swag. This will be updated as well throughout the week when we know what will happen with the wind.

Today was a blast, we had a solid 20 knts once 2 o'clock came around. Mike hall was on the PA the whole day while the crew from photoboat.com buzzed around on the course in two specially rigged zodiacs taking documenting all the fun.

There were tons of spring breakers loungin on the party island all day long, cheering the kiters down wind in the zone. Schools at the event included eckerd college and fsu, while there were loads of students at the event from colleges/ universities in georgia, michigan, texas, and north carolina.
